A Maintenance Assistant plays a key supporting role in ensuring the upkeep and smooth operation of buildings, facilities, or equipment.

    • AI Exposure: Low

      This role has a low level of AI exposure. Core skills such as adaptability, social intelligence, and complex physical tasks remain beyond the capabilities of current AI.

In Brisbane, aspiring Maintenance Assistants have an array of options to choose from with 14 beginner-friendly Maintenance Assistant courses in Brisbane. Whether you are interested in hands-on roles or technical support within various industries, the courses available will equip you with essential skills. Popular choices include the Certificate II in Process Plant Operations and the Certificate II in Engineering, both known for providing practical training to help you excel in your future career.

The training is delivered by reputable Registered Training Organisations (RTOs) in the Brisbane area, such as CERT Training and LSHS, ensuring quality education that meets industry standards. For those looking to specialise further, the Use Hand and Power Tools course offered by KT is an excellent option to enhance your practical skills.

Completing these Maintenance Assistant courses in Brisbane can open up a world of opportunities in various sectors, from utilities to construction. With providers like AUSINET teaching skills in electrical safety testing and Adapt Education offering broader industry knowledge, you will be well-prepared for the workforce.
